Transaction d88d7364b7893f133e49c679ea23e32dba7bdf5ddacaa2c3acb71e244b96ca75
1 Input
1 Output
-
d88d7364b7893f133e49c679ea23e32dba7bdf5ddacaa2c3acb71e244b96ca75:0
- value
- 20672900
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 726fa040bc445d35c7516991a40b35915aabda69 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BS5kn96gVLtWcH3o38jnfxH2xoUxcK2ge